Bantams at Kew Association Football Club
Kingston Little League in partnership with Kew Association Football Club have established the KLL (Ham and Richmond Division) which provides football coaching for boys and girls aged 5 (U6) to 8 (U9) years-old (Bantams) as at 1 September 2012. Please register as above for places starting in September 2012.
Registration at Latchmere on Saturday 8th September. Coaching will restart on Saturday 15th September. For further details see this site Kingston Little League (Ham & Richmond Division).
This is an extension of the Bantams concept to the Ham and Richmond area to provide additional spaces to what is already an over subscribed Bantams section on Dinton. Players at the KLL (Ham & Richmond Division) will graduate to Sevens as U10 players in the same way Bantams move up now.
The cost will cover same period as Bantams on Dinton.
